What grads earn
$40,186/ yr
Median earnings 4 years after completion — $37,998 adjusted to national cost of living (local prices 6% above average).
53% of students out-earn a typical high-school graduate (about $28,500) within 10 years.

Opportunity Insights
Economic mobility
Access
3.7%
from the bottom income fifth
Success
20%
of them reach the top fifth
Mobility rate
0.7%
move bottom → top
The mobility rate is how many of Berklee College of Music’s students both start in the bottom income fifth and reach the top — a measure of who the school lifts, not just who it admits.
